Kindle Keyboard 3g/wifi demo unit

Don't know if this is the right part of the forum or not for this question.
I was recently given free of charge a kindle keyboard 3g/wi-fi demo unit.
It was being thrown away.
My question is there anyway to wipe the demo and put the regular os or and alternative os on this unit so that I can use it?
Any assistance would be greatly appreciated.

you can use kite to run a command like this:
Code:
#!/bin/sh
mntroot rw
/usr/sbin/factory_reset
mntroot ro
may work
